Subject: Give me ideas for short grain leg tower



NW Iowa
I'm nestling a 50' 3100 bph leg between a 9 1/2 ring 30' top dry (25' eve height) and an 11 1/2 ring (30.5' eves) top dry bin. Bins are 6' apart. Leg will feed a Schlagel 1214 reversing conveyor that will supply the two top dry's and another 1214 that will supply a 4500 bushel hoppered wet bin. Will need one (maybe two) support towers for the catwalk holding the conveyor. My plan right now is to build a 40' 6'x6' support tower for the conveyor and tie the leg to the side of it. Can I use the stiffened walls of the top dry's for some support so that I can use less materials for the tower? Any ideas on how much concrete under the tower, materials for the tower itself, and how I need to cable the top 10' of the leg would be appreciated. Picture of the layout is attached.
